Egypt: Islamic fintech startup backed by Plus Venture Capital, Flat6labs, others
Egypt-based Islamic fintech, Agel, has concluded its pre-seed funding round at an undisclosed seven-digit figure. The round was led by Plus Venture Capital (+VC), Seedstars International Ventures, Flat6labs, and involved participation from SEEDRA Ventures, Banque Misr, and several angel investors.
Agel specialises in digital, cashless, and Sharia-compliant financing products for Egypt’s micro, small, and medium enterprises (MSMEs). It has already established a significant presence in Egypt’s $15bn annual textiles industry and plans to diversify into other sectors.
Agel’s newly secured capital will be utilised for its evolution into a licensed non-banking financial institution, further product development, and expansion into Egypt’s main cities. A co-branded merchant banking card service, in partnership with Abu Dhabi Islamic Bank (ADIB), is also in the pipeline.
